Задать вопрос
Ответы пользователя по тегу Android
  • Можно ли подключить телефонный звонок к скайпу?

    @MoonMaster
    Программист и этим все сказано
    Не знаю как в обычном скайпе, но в Skype for Business такая возможность есть. Там нужно создать Skype meteeng и появится ссылка на сам митинг и телефоны, по которым к нему можно подключиться
    Ответ написан
    Комментировать
  • Почему так происходит?

    @MoonMaster
    Программист и этим все сказано
    Проблема в области видимости переменной j. Дело в том, что ваша переменная видна только в case 1 и больше нигде. Поэтому компилятор и ругается в том, что нельзя присвоить значение. Объявите переменную j вначале цикла или сделайте её статической и у вас все заработает. Например так
    import java.io.IOException;
    import java.io.PrintWriter;
    import java.util.Scanner;
    
    public class Apply {
    
        Scanner myConsoleScanner = new Scanner (System.in);
        PrintWriter myPrinter = new PrintWriter (System.out);
        static String j;
    
        public static void main(String[] args) {
            try{
                Apply.rhyme ();
            }
            catch (IOException ex){
                ex.printStackTrace ();
            }
        }
    
        public static void rhyme() throws IOException {
            String a1 = "Двадцать один, Тридцать один, Сорок один, Пятьдесят один";
            String a2 = "Двадцать два, Тридцать два, Сорок два, Пятьдесят два";
    
            for(int i = 1; i <= 100; i++) {
                switch(i) {
                    case 1:
                        j = a1;
                        break;
                    case 2:
                        j = a2; break;
                }
                System.out.println("У числа " + i + "эти рифмы : " + j );
            }
        }
    }
    Ответ написан
    1 комментарий
  • Как думаете, почему для разработки android выбрали язык java?

    @MoonMaster
    Программист и этим все сказано
    Мне кажется ответ прост и очевиден. Язык Java кроссплатформенный, а это значит, что приложения можно создавать под любую машину Android (за исключением особенностей каждой версии Android).
    Разработчиков Java очень много. Тому пример популярные языки программирования.
    Ну и последний аргумент в пользу Java это её архитектура. Насколько я знаю приложения для Android и приложения на Java отличаются Dalvik (Dalvik)
    Ответ написан